The sixth leg of the Horseware/TRM Premier Series 2014 took place today at Tattersalls July Show in Ratoath, Co. Meath.

42 starters took on Tom Holden’s track and just 11 combinations made it to the second round for the Horseware/TRM Premier Grand Prix, supported by the Friends of Rolestown and ShowjumpingIreland and carrying a purse of €10,000.  

It was on form Greg Broderick who stormed home with a double clear in 52.65 and took the top spot with the Caledonia Stables owned MHS Going Global, rounding off a very successful weekend for the Tipperary rider who yesterday took the National Grand Prix with the ever consistent Rincarina.

A steadier double clear gave Eddie Moloney to take second place and a time fault in both rounds to give a total of two was enough to give Capt/ Geoff Curran and the distinctively marked Mullaghbane third place.

The top three riders on the Horseware/TRM Premier Series Leaderboard after Tattersalls get automatic qualification for the Discover Ireland Dublin Horse Show in August.  Greg was already guaranteed his place at the RDS and this gives him extra points to move clear at the top of the Premier leaderboard with MHS Going Global top of the Horse table to date.

Joan Greene kept the second place on the leaderboard and Eddie Moloney’s strong second place finish at today’s leg ensured him the third place at the RDS.

With just two legs of the series left the Horse/TRM Premier Series now moves to South County Show in Coilog Equestrian Centre for the seventh leg on Sunday 3rd August.

*Full Result* Sixth leg of the Horseware/TRM Premier Series 2014 at Tattersalls July Show

1st Greg Broderick/MHS Going Global 0/0 51.65
2nd Eddie Moloney/Chatsworth Dan 0/0 60.84
3rd Capt Geoff Curran/Mullaghbane 1/1 64.54
4th Alexander Butler/Will Wimble 0/4 48.64
5th Clem McMahon/Any Questions 4/0 50.58
6th Paddy O'Donnell/Harristown Princess 4/0 50.80
7th Edward Butler/Caugherty 0/4 56.09
8th Damien Griffin/Tabby 4/4 50.97
9th Tom Slattery/Castleforbes Paddington 4/4 51.72
10th Alexander Butler/Vimminka 0/8 54.22

42 Starters
11 in Jump Off
Winning Owner - Caledonia Stables
